Header Ads Widget

Responsive Advertisement

Define React Component As Function

This is an alias for FunctionalComponent which is also acceptable. The new way of setting the state in a Typescript React component is really nice and protects your state object from mutations.

A Complete Beginner S Guide To React Freecodecamp Org Beginners Guide Learn To Code Beginners

Functional components are just like a.

Define react component as function. Just be careful and bind it to the correct context in onClick event. Sure this might not be critical for expert devs we are all still humans right but for new devs this can definitely help prevent common mistakes which are. Components come in two types Class components and Function components in this tutorial we will concentrate on Class components.

The browser will work hard to ensure that there are 60 frames per second 60 fps. These are simply JavaScript functions. They serve the same purpose as JavaScript functions but work in isolation and return HTML via a render function.

A function that is queued with requestAnimationFrame will fire in the next frame. A functional component is basically a JavaScript or ES6 function which returns a React element. In this post we are going to go through how we can use the Reacts useState function to manage state within a strongly-typed functional component with TypeScript.

A common mistake here is to call the function right away like in the HTML example. They offer performance benefits decreased coupling and greater reusability. Instead of calling the function when the button is clicked it will be called every time the component renders.

Import React from react. Functional components are easier to read debug and test. Class Hello extends Component render return Hello World export default Hello.

Lets understand this with a basic example of what an inline function might look like in a React application. This rule is automatically fixable using the --fix flag on the command line. In react we can render the components in two methods one is using class components and the other is using functional components.

As of React v168 function-based components have a lot more capability which includes the ability to manage state. If you look closely we havent typed our Child component function either. As far as I know functions defined in the parent component can only be used by the child component.

In React terms a component is usually defined as a function of its state and props. A Functional component is a function that takes props and returns JSX They do not have state or lifecycle methods. This rule is aimed to enforce consistent function types for function components.

Well also import ReactElement which will be the return signature of the function. Return h1 Hello World h1. Inside the code above the class Hello extends Reacts Component class but you havent.

These functions may or may not receive data as parameters. HandleClick e thissaySomething. Export default class Archive extends ReactComponent saySomething something consolelog something.

Enforce a specific function type for function components reactfunction-component-definition This option enforces a specific function type for function components. Simply put an inline function is a function that is defined and passed down inside the render method of a React component. Class components and functional components.

Const FunctionalComponent React. RequestAnimationFrame is a way of queuing a function to be executed in the browser at the optimal time for rendering performance. In the past there have been various React Component Types but with the introduction of React Hooks its possible to write your entire application with just functions as React components.

It is actually regular ES6 class which inherits from ReactComponent. Is there any way I can define and call a function within the child component. We can create a functional component to React by writing a JavaScript function.

Components are independent and reusable bits of code. A functional component is a plain JavaScript function. You can create functions in react components.

Outside of a dog a book is a. React Function Components -- also known as React Functional Components -- are the status quo of writing modern React applications. Thankfully we can make use of the React types library by simply importing the FC type.

Function Welcome props return Hello propsname. We define the sendMessage function as a variable at the beginning of the component. I need to define a function that will be called from the child component itself.

We are going to build a sign up form like the one below. The error Component is not defined is triggered when you use the Component class in React without actually importing it. According to React official docs the function below is a valid React component.

Class components React supports two flavors of components. There used to be a componentWillMount that happens before the first render but it is considered legacy and not recommended to use in newer versions of React. Functional components are some of the more common components that will come across while working in React.

UseEffect console.

Native Navigation Using React Native Navigation Example React Native Navigation Nativity

Pin On React Js

Pin On Code Geek

Using Props Children With React Function Components In 2021 Components Function Start Up

Pin On React Native App Development Solutions

Pin On Infographics

Pin On Web Pixer

Pin By Bretmyevolv On React Software Testing Server Rendering

Pin On React Js

Pure Functional Components In React 16 6 Coding Camp Coding Pure Products

Pin On Code

This Tutorial Explains How To Use Default Props In React Application A React Component Is Simply A Javascript Function React App Web Programming Complete Guide

React Stateless Functional Components Nine Wins You Might Have Overlooked Coding Camp Components Deep Learning

Pin On React Js

Graphql Schema Use Case And Functions Use Case Data Science Define Data

Pin On Code Geek

Pin On React

React Hooks Tutorial On Pure Usereducer Usecontext For Global State Like Redux And Comparison Pure Products Tutorial Global

Pin On Web Development Links


Posting Komentar

0 Komentar